- What You Should Know About PIP Arbitration CasesMar 21, 2018 If you are a resident of New Jersey who has found yourself in an auto accident, it is imperative that you have a thorough understanding of the PIP arbitration process. New Jersey’s Personal Injury Protection insurance system is intended to provide medical expense benefits, continued income, money for essential services, and funeral or death costs. - Construction Accident Injuries: One of the Most Dangerous Industries in the USDec 28, 2017 As the construction industry continues to boom, the rates of accidents, injuries, and deaths are increasing. The construction industry is the 2nd most fatal industry in the United States, with falls being the most significant source of disastrous construction industries. The most-violated OSHA (Occupational Safety and Health Administration) standard is fall protection. More than half of construction workplace injuries occur within the first year of employment.
